Belleville, AR vs Des Arc, AR
Des Arc is moderately more affordable than Belleville, with a 9.5% lower cost of living index. Belleville scores 58 compared to 53 for Des Arc,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Belleville can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.
On the housing front, median rent in Belleville is $671/month compared to $503/month in Des Arc — a 33%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Des Arc has cheaper rent, Belleville actually has lower median home values ($86,400 vs $86,800).
Median household income in Belleville is $65,815 compared to $31,328 in Des Arc (+110.1%). While Belleville is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Belleville spend roughly 12.2% of their income on rent, less than the 19.3% in Des Arc.
